# Ledgerloom Admin — Environments

Heads up for release planning: bulk edits in the admin table behave differently per environment. On staging, batch size is capped low so QA can watch row-level audit events fire; on prod we crank it up and throttle per-tenant so a giant bulk edit doesn't starve the queue. If you're cutting a release that touches the bulk editor, sanity-check both environments first — drift here has bitten us twice. The production environment is currently configured as follows.

config for kagup-hahig:
druwyn:
  pin: 2801
  metrics_host: metrics.druwyn.zemvarlabs.internal
  tenant: sorius
  seal: seal_798a43d7

# Env Vars: Planner Regression Mitigation

After the query planner regression in Corvid DB 9.3, Fernwell's release builds must pin the legacy planner until the patched build ships. Set `CORVID_PLANNER_MODE=legacy` in the release env file and confirm it with the preflight check before tagging. The planner override endpoint requires authentication, so the release env file also needs the planner override token on the next line.

env line for kahof-fajeg: ARCHIVE_KEY3=397

# Inventory reconciliation job — StockLedger by Varnholt Goods.
# This env file configures the nightly job that compares warehouse counts
# in the Drenfield depot against the ledger snapshot. Reviewers: note that
# RECON_BATCH_SIZE stays at 500 to avoid lock contention on the counts table,
# and RECON_DRY_RUN must be false in production only. The job authenticates
# to the ledger API using the credential set on the next line.

env line for fafof-fahag: LEDGER_TOKEN5=f8790

## Deployment

The Sproutly watering scheduler deploys from the main branch via the Greenhatch pipeline. New team members should deploy to the sandbox cluster first and verify the valve simulator responds before touching production. Secrets come from the team vault; everything else is plain config. The standard sandbox configuration is listed below.

service settings:
[casax]
port = 6379
team = rusir
host = casax.zemvarhq.corp
region = outer-4
access_code = ac_9808ce
timeout_ms = 1500